The Sacrifice Game plays with that eerie isolation you feel in a boarding school setting, especially during the holidays. It’s 1971, and you’ve got Samantha and Clara holding down the fort, which sets the stage for a tense atmosphere. The pacing keeps you on edge as the uninvited visitors bring chaos into their quiet world. There's a rawness to the practical effects that feels refreshing, grounding the horror in reality rather than digital gloss. The performances have a palpable intensity, particularly how the two leads navigate fear and desperation. The film’s themes of survival and trust are explored in a way that feels both retro and relevant, making it a curious watch for genre enthusiasts.
